You will need some way to trigger both flashes, PC chords to both or to one with a slave on the other or some wireless set up.PRESTON A : I am not sure if two flash units can be mounted on this bracket, however, you should be aware of a problem I encountered with this item. (This may be a bit hard to explain so please bear with me). I had a problem using this hand bracket with an off-camera cord. The mechanical interface between the off-camera cord's flash mounting head and hand bracket was not very sturdy and, during "normal" use, the foot of the flash mounting head broke. The flash mounting head does have a screw hole on the bottom where the mechanical interface can be strenghtened (with a bolt from below), however, there are no holes in the hand bracket's mounts to do this. The next time I will be using this hand bracket I am planning on modifying it by drilling holes so I can bolt the flash mounting head to the hand bracket. I hope the explaination of my problem with the hand bracket makes sense.KIRIT K : Yes you canLUCIAN C : I'm going to give you a qualified yes.
